Instructional Media Design is above average in terms of popularity with it being the #98 most popular degree program in the country. This means you won't have too much trouble finding schools that offer the degree.

College Factual looked at 10 colleges and universities when compiling its 2024 Best Instructional Media Design Schools in Florida ranking. Combined, these schools handed out 260 degrees in instructional media design to qualified students.

In order to come up with a best overall ranking for instructional media design schools, we combine our degree-level rankings, weighting them by the number of degrees awarded at each level.

Florida State University
Tallahassee, FL
Doctor's Degree Highest Degree Type
38 Instructional Media Degrees Awarded
18.4% Growth in Graduates

Every student who is interested in instructional media design needs to check out Florida State University. Florida State is a very large public university located in the medium-sized city of Tallahassee. A Best Colleges rank of #121 out of 2,217 colleges nationwide means Florida State is a great university overall.

There were about 38 instructional media design students who graduated with this degree at Florida State in the most recent year we have data available. Graduates who receive their degree from the instructional media program earn around $49,060 in the first couple years of their career.
